Hello,

I just filed 20 bugs on packages that FTBFS with Django 1.8. They have
two weeks to be fixed before we upload Django 1.8 to unstable.

https://bugs.debian.org/cgi-bin/pkgreport.cgi?users=python-django@packages.debian.org;tag=django18

If you maintain a package in the Django ecosystem, please double check
that it's ready for Django 1.8. The fact that it doesn't fail to build
does not mean that it will necessarily work if you don't have any tests
or if you don't run them.

If you file more bugs related to Django 1.8, don't hesitate to add
the "django18" usertag associated to the
"python-django@packages.debian.org" user. (I wish we could easily
rerun the DEP-8 functional tests with a new version of the package)
